11 of us, ages ranging from 12 months to 69 years went on a week's holiday together. We stayed on the Algarve at Praia da Luz in a 5 bedroom 5 bathroomed villa, with private pool.
We had a lovely time
We barbecued at the villa a couple of nights , had a simple pasta meal one night, ate out twice and ordered takeaways one night.
You need a lot of shopping for that many people!
We use Tricount, which I will make thread about.
The villa was spacious with air conditioning and there were 3 outdoor areas (Lower poolside, mid terrace with big table and barbecue, and rooftop terrace) So plenty of room to spread out.
The pool of course was the main attraction for everyone. There were many inflatable toys and a lilo, and sunloungers and chairs for everyone..
We had a beach trip and looked at market stalls, and DD1 and SIL2 took the older boys to the zoo one morning. I think we all wanted to relax and recharge on this holiday so were happy to be mainly villa based, especially on a holiday of only one week.
Baby was a pleasure to be with all week, including both flights. He delighted us all. He loved being with his cousins. He especially loves being with his 7 year old cousin, he was so good with him.
The children all got along well. GS1 seemed to need large amounts of alone time each day which was a bit disappointing for GS2 who was longing to play with him. DD2, GD and I played 'Guess what animal I am?' in the pool with him several times
I will write more about GD specifically in YEO, but all was good.
I feel very fortunate to have shared this time with my family, especially GS3's first holiday.
